Neat Edges With Back Stapled Build

We always back staple our canvases to ensure a smooth and clean gallery look. This process may take longer and require more materials, but we believe it is worth it. Professional Canvas Ready To Use

CanvasLot stretched canvases are primed and ready to go, featuring 100 percent cotton and two coats of acid free gesso. The surface allows paints to glide naturally and blend beautifully. After painting, just hang your canvas with the included D rings already fixed to the frame.
